Add 14/75 and 60/36
1st number: 14/75, 2nd number: 1 24/36
14/75 + 60/36 is 139/75.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 75 and 36 is 900
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 900 - For the 1st fraction, since 75 × 12 = 900,
14/75 = 14 × 12/75 × 12 = 168/900 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 36 × 25 = 900,
60/36 = 60 × 25/36 × 25 = 1500/900 - Add the two like fractions:
168/900 + 1500/900 = 168 + 1500/900 = 1668/900 - 1668/900 simplified gives 139/75
- So, 14/75 + 60/36 = 139/75
In mixed form: 164/75
